Abstract :
The main objective of the research is to define and propose a framework for data hibernation in the workflows under intrusion threat. When the intrusion is detected, the data services need to be discontinued immediately to retain the security and the integrity of the valuable data, till the system is recovered from the threat. By discontinuing data services, the end users may face inconveniences in using the system because of its temporary unavailability. Data hibernation addresses a mechanism of secure transferring of data and providing an access of the data alternatively keeping the data integrity intact. Data hibernation involves three steps i.e. designing an alternate schema for storing data, transferring data to that alternate storage and providing an access to that data. Hence the system can continue to provide data services securely to the end user even in the threat situations.
